THANET OFFSHORE WIND FARM
NOTICE OF GRANTING OF CONSENT FOR IMPLEMENTATION OF SAFETY ZONE SCHEME DURING CONSTRUCTION OF THE THANET OFFSHORE WIND FARM OFF THE COAST OF THANET IN NORTH EAST KENT.
THE ELECTRICITY (OFFSHORE GENERATING STATIONS) (SAFETY ZONES) (APPLICATION PROCEDURES AND CONTROL OF ACCESS) REGULATIONS 2007 – STATUTORY INSTRUMENT 2007 NO.1948
Notice is hereby given that Thanet Offshore Wind Limited (Registration number 4512200) (The “Company”) (whose registered office is at c/o Warrener Stewart, Harwood House, 43 Harwood Road, London SW6 4QP, has been granted:
Consent from the Secretary of State for Energy and Climate Change as set out in the Energy Act 2004 and the Electricity (Offshore Generating Stations) (Safety Zones) (Application Procedures and Control of Access) Regulations 2007 (SI No 2007/1948) for a Safety Zone scheme to be placed around the offshore substation platform and the individual WTG/foundation structures during construction of the previously consented offshore renewable energy installation known as the Thanet Offshore Wind Farm off the coast of Thanet in north east Kent.
